Default electrolytic derusting (EDR) question

I have this old set of casters I'm trying to save. Steel everything, quite
rusted. They still turn but sound like a sack of cats. These don't disassemble
and the replacement ones have plastic wheels. Yuck. So I'm trying to get the
rust off. These are stem casters, 7/16"x1-9/16" stem, 2" wheels. Yesterday I
suspended one by the stem into an electrolytic derusting solution and gave it
a whirl. The caster housing derusted beautifully but there is apparently too
little electrical contact with the wheel to have any effect.

How can I EDR the wheel? I thought of soft-soldering a wire to the rim of
the wheel and suspending it by the wire (with just the top of the wheel
out of the solution). Is there any better way?
